React hook form forwardref typescript

WebAug 17, 2024 · import React, {forwardRef, useState, useRef, useEffect, useCallback, useImperativeHandle} from 'react'; export const NumericCellEditor = forwardRef((props, ref) => { const [value, setValue] = useState(parseInt(props.value)); const … WebApr 11, 2024 · React 中的 forwardRef 是一个非常重要的 API,因为它能帮我们处理一些特殊场景,比如文中提到的访问子组件的 DOM 节点或者用于编写高阶组件。. 通过使用 forwardRef API,我们能更加方便的操作 React 组件,还能大大提高我们的开发效率。. 因此,掌握 React 中的 ...

useForm - register React Hook Form - Simple React forms …

WebNov 25, 2024 · We can acheive this with forwardRef from React: const Search = React . forwardRef ( ( props , ref ) => { return < input ref = { ref } type = " search " /> ; } ) ; We wrap … WebTypeScript caveat Unstyled Select accepts generic props. Due to TypeScript limitations, this may cause unexpected behavior when wrapping the component in forwardRef (or other higher-order components). In such cases, the generic argument will be defaulted to unknown and type suggestions will be incomplete. irish the hedgehog jacksepticeye https://completemagix.com

reactjs - react-select 与 react-hook-form 和是的 - 堆栈内存溢出

WebApr 11, 2024 · React 中的 forwardRef 是一个非常重要的 API,因为它能帮我们处理一些特殊场景,比如文中提到的访问子组件的 DOM 节点或者用于编写高阶组件。. 通过使用 … WebFeb 24, 2024 · import { useEffect } from 'react'; import { useForm } from 'react-hook-form'; import { MyBeautifulInput } from './MyBeautifulInput'; type Form = { category: string; }; … WebTypeScript. React Hook Form is built with TypeScript, and you can define a FormData type to support form values. CodeSandbox. import * as React from "react"; import { useForm } … irish textile companies

Using forwardRef with React hooks - Plain English

Category:reactjs - react-hook-form How to access the RegisterOptions that …

Tags:React hook form forwardref typescript

React hook form forwardref typescript

forwardRef/createRef React TypeScript Cheatsheets

WebApr 12, 2024 · React Hook Form and Typescript make it easy to build powerful and maintainable forms in React. By using types and a powerful validation library like Zod, we can catch errors early and ensure that ... WebApr 4, 2024 · The Form component shouldn't care which DOM element we're using or whether we even use DOM elements or something else at all. Separation of concerns, you …

React hook form forwardref typescript

Did you know?

WebMay 18, 2024 · The forwardRef API is pretty straight-forward. You wrap your component in a function call, with is passed props and the forwarded ref, and you're then supposed to return your component. Here's a simple example in JavaScript: const Button = React.forwardRef( (props, forwardedRef) =&gt; ( ) ); WebMar 29, 2024 · If you want to allow people to take a ref to your function component, you can use forwardRef. interface ChildComponentProps { title: string; } const ChildComponent = …

WebRefs &amp; 函数组件-【官方】百战程序员_IT在线教育培训机构_体系课程在线学习平台 ... . 登录 / 注册 WebMay 28, 2024 · It's important to note that when using React Hooks that all custom editors should be wrapped in React.forwardRef and all ag-Grid lifecycle methods should be returned in React.useImperativeHandle. Learn more about ag-Grid Custom Editors Learn more about using React Hooks with ag-Grid Asynchronous Validation See component code

WebTo know when the component has been mounted, we need to use the useEffect hook. Add it to the imports. import { useRef, useEffect } from "react"; Let's define the useEffect , and … WebDec 12, 2024 · Overview of React Hook Form Typescript example. We will implement validation and submit for a React Typescript Form using React Hook Form 7 and …

WebOct 12, 2024 · Sometimes you want to forward refs to children components. To do that in React we have to wrap the component with forwardRef. Here's the link to the React …

WebThis method allows you to register an input or select element and apply validation rules to React Hook Form. Validation rules are all based on the HTML standard and also allow for custom validation methods. By invoking the register function and supplying an input's name, you will receive the following methods: Props Return port for wireguardWeb23 hours ago · So in react-hook-forms you can define a custom field/input using: const MyInput = React.forwardRef ( ( { name, label, ...rest }, ref) => { return ( <> {label} ); }); then to use it, we pass a register () function with the options/object: port for wireless printerWebApr 6, 2024 · Things become trickier when the element you need access to is rendered inside of a child component. In this case, you have to wrap the child component into the … port for windowsWebSide note: the ref you get from forwardRef is mutable so you can assign to it if needed. This was done on purpose . You can make it immutable if you have to - assign React.Ref if you want to ensure nobody reassigns it: irish theme gift basketWebNov 3, 2024 · That makes sense. The types in the react-hook-form package made me think that it would be able to convert the object to a string and the input component would be … port for wsusWebDec 12, 2024 · React Custom Hook Typescript example. Let’s say that we build a React Typescript application with the following 2 components: – TutorialsList: get a list of … port for womenWeb2 days ago · ではSelectFieldを使ってみましょう。. 先程のInputFieldと並べてみます。. レイアウトの責務をFieldWrapperに任せることで、意図しないレイアウト崩れを防ぐことが … irish themed clip art